For Honor Live Update Error 2 00003802

Posted on August 18, 2022 by Emmitt Rodriguez

For Honor Live Update Error 2 00003802 is a problem that some players have been experiencing recently. The error causes the game to crash, and the only fix at the moment is to uninstall and reinstall it.

Ubisoft is aware of the problem and is currently working on a fix. In the meantime, they suggest players try the following workarounds:

– If you are using a firewall, add “Uplay.exe” and “ForHonor.exe” to the list of allowed programs

– If you are using a VPN, disable it

– Try running the game in Windows 7 compatibility mode

Players have also been reporting that disabling Nvidia GeForce Experience seems to help.

Why do I keep getting disconnected from Ubisoft servers for honor?

There could be a variety of reasons why you’re experiencing frequent disconnections from Ubisoft servers while playing For Honor.

First, make sure that your network is up to spec by checking your internet speed at Speedtest.net. If your download speed is below 10 Mbps, you may experience gameplay issues, including disconnections.

If your network is up to par, there are a few other things you can do to improve your gameplay experience:

– Make sure your console or PC is up to date with the latest system software and drivers.

– Close any other programs or applications that are using your internet connection, including streaming services like Netflix or Hulu.

– Try connecting to a different network, if possible.

If you’ve tried all of the above and are still experiencing frequent disconnections, it’s possible that there is an issue with Ubisoft’s servers. Unfortunately, there isn’t much you can do except wait for Ubisoft to address the issue. In the meantime, you may want to try playing on a different platform, if possible.

Why can’t I connect to the For Honor servers?

There are a number of reasons why you may not be able to connect to the For Honor servers. The most common reasons are listed below.

Connection Issues

One of the most common reasons for not being able to connect to the For Honor servers is that your connection is not stable enough. If you are experiencing frequent disconnections, it is likely that the game servers are not the problem, but rather your internet connection. In this case, you may want to try using a different internet connection or contact your internet service provider for assistance.

Firewall and Antivirus Software

Another common reason for not being able to connect to the For Honor servers is that your firewall or antivirus software is blocking the game. If you are using a firewall or antivirus software, you will need to make sure that the game is allowed to connect to the internet.
